Cognitive behavior modification (CBT).
CBT focuses on transforming negative patterns of assuming and behavior that may be creating PTSD symptoms. This treatment is typically short-term and client-centered, with the specialist and client creating treatment goals together. CBT has been revealed to reduce PTSD signs and symptoms in a number of clinical tests utilizing clinician-administered and self-report measures of PTSD. These outcomes are mediated mainly by changes in maladaptive cognitive distortions, with some researches reporting physiological, useful neuroimaging, and electroencephalographic changes associating with action to CBT.
TF-CBT utilizes psychoeducation and imaginal direct exposure to educate clients just how to much better regulate feelings and manage their injuries. This therapy has additionally been revealed to enhance PTSD signs in youngsters and adolescents.
Eye motion desensitization and reprocessing (EMDR).
EMDR is an evidence-based therapy that works by aiding individuals process trauma making use of adaptive information processing. It can be utilized by itself or with various other therapies. It has actually been shown to be efficient in treating PTSD. EMDR is commonly used around the globe.
It begins with history-taking and a collaborative therapy strategy. Throughout this phase, you will certainly talk about the factor you are seeking treatment and identify traumatic memories you wish to concentrate on. The therapist will certainly additionally instruct you strategies to manage any type of tough or distressing feelings that may develop throughout a session.
Throughout the reprocessing phase, you will certainly recall a traumatic memory while focusing on a back-and-forth activity or sound (like your supplier's hand moving across your face) up until the adverse images, ideas, and feelings connected with it start to diminish.
Somatic experiencing.
A therapist that concentrates on this method will aid you become aware of the physical feelings that accompany your PTSD signs. They'll additionally teach you exactly how to recognize your free nervous system and its role in the trauma feedback.
Unlike other trauma therapies, somatic experiencing does not concentrate on memories or feelings. Instead, therapists work to launch the stress from your body and alleviate your signs.
This therapy has actually been found effective in a number of randomized controlled tests. Nevertheless, the arise from these researches are limited by small sample sizes and various other technical shortages. These imperfections restrict the external validity of these findings.
Present-centered therapy.
Present-centered therapy (PCT) is a non-trauma focused psychiatric therapy that intends to improve clients' partnerships, infuse hope and positive outlook, and advertise problem-solving. While PCT lacks direct exposure and cognitive restructuring strategies of trauma-focused therapies, it has been shown to be as efficient in minimizing PTSD signs and symptoms as trauma-focused CBTs.
In ptsd treatment a collection of eleven researches, PCT was contrasted to a delay list or minimal contact control condition and to TF-CBT. PCT was superior to the WL/MA conditions in decreasing self-reported PTSD signs at post-treatment, and it was connected with reduced treatment dropout rates. However, the effect size was not large enough to be clinically meaningful.

Double diagnosis therapy.
Signs and symptoms of co-occurring PTSD and compound use problem (SUD) are usually connected and both should be addressed in recuperation. Individuals who experience PTSD can be more likely to turn to alcohol or medicines to self-medicate and briefly reduce invasive ideas, flashbacks and adverse state of mind swings.
PTSD symptoms consist of frequent and involuntary distressing memories or desires, vibrant and dissociative responses that feel like reliving the occasion, preventing areas, individuals, conversations, or things associated with the injury, feelings of hypervigilance and being always on guard or easily stunned, and feelings of psychological pins and needles.
Twin diagnosis therapy includes therapy and discovering healthier coping devices. It may additionally involve pharmacotherapy, such as antidepressants or state of mind stabilizers.
